About the position:

  1. The Department of Computer Science & Engineering at the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Roorkee invites applications from outstanding and enthusiastic researchers for Postdoctoral Position for working on a project focused of. “Emotion enabled sign language recognition using multiple sensors”.
  2. The candidate is expected to join the Department as soon as offer letter has been released.
  • The fellow will receive a consolidated fellowship as below in addition to the contingency grant of ₹ 50,000/-per annum.
  • First two years: ₹ 55,000/- per month
  • Third-year: ₹ 60,000/- per month (If extended)

Eligibility Criteria:

  • Good publication record in Image Processing/Computer Vision/Pattern Recognition/Machine Learning and Ph.D. in one of these research areas (Image Processing/Computer Vision/Pattern Recognition/Machine Learning).
  • Candidate must have knowledge of traditional and deep feature extraction for machine learning and good background knowledge in signal processing.
  • Candidates who have recently submitted their doctoral thesis are also eligible to apply subject to the condition that they will furnish the proof of award of Ph.D. degree at the time of interview.
  1. The prospective candidate is expected to have a strong background in image processing and machine learning.
  2. The prior knowledge of object detection and recognition in image/video will be considered as added qualification.
  3. Candidate should be passionate about working in pattern recognition problems.
